Transaction 975360e559e078e739d33b953c5afd63dfd5a923be9b9ce325c35c58a33b74a5

28 Input
2 Outputs
  • 975360e559e078e739d33b953c5afd63dfd5a923be9b9ce325c35c58a33b74a5:0
  • value  667482833
    address  3F5xyMiMityzeMVExpXXK2VZptxJUUpsXt
  • 975360e559e078e739d33b953c5afd63dfd5a923be9b9ce325c35c58a33b74a5:1
  • value  747158
    address  34sdv4KpmVhc1rHAt2d4f9YGzpEawfZjT6